JsDiagram: JsDiagram is an open-source JavaScript library for creating diagrams and charts in web applications. It allows developers to easily add flowcharts, UML diagrams, BPMN diagrams, ER diagrams, network diagrams, and more using a simple API.

Metasploit: Metasploit is an open source penetration testing framework that helps security professionals find, exploit, and validate vulnerabilities. It includes a database of known exploits and payloads that can be used to simulate attacks against systems to test their security.

Metasploit
Metasploit Features
  • Exploit database
  • Payload database
  • Auxiliary modules
  • Evasion modules
  • Post-exploitation modules
  • Scripting engine

Metasploit
Metasploit

Pros

  • Comprehensive and frequently updated exploit database
  • Large collection of payloads
  • Modular architecture
  • Built-in evasion techniques
  • Powerful CLI and scripting capabilities
  • Active community support

Cons

  • Can be complex for beginners
  • Requires familiarity with penetration testing concepts
  • Exploits can be unreliable and may crash targets
  • Legal and ethical concerns around offensive security testing
